Transaction 496650f1f02c0758dcb07abf3e36f4f39db94eb81f04445544814a52ef629201

2 Input
1 Outputs
  • 496650f1f02c0758dcb07abf3e36f4f39db94eb81f04445544814a52ef629201:0
  • value  121357
    address  16UgKjTEwcbUudS1nxi1fZBiHWrjpXTDPx